We often confuse love with making life easy, especially when it comes to parenting 💛

And I get it, children are persuasive 😄😜

The tears, the drama, the strong will and endless desires and big, big emotions. It's no joke 🤭

So we soften consequences.
We delay correction.
We explain again and again hoping our children will simply “understand.”

Because we love them.

But when you look at the love of God, you see something deeper 🙏🙏

“The Lord disciplines the one He loves.” (Hebrews 12:6)

God’s love comforts us in our weakness,
but it doesn’t leave us there.

It guides us and corrects us and shapes us into who we are meant to become 💛

And in the same way, biblical parenting is not just about comforting our children or managing their emotions.

It’s about formation 🌱

It’s about loving leadership in the early years —
consistent boundaries, steady correction, intentional guidance.

Like if a toddler reaches for the stove while dinner is cooking;
You don’t gently negotiate, you move their hand and say “No.”
That firmness isn’t harshness. It’s love protecting them from harm.

And when your child cries because they don’t want bedtime yet.
You comfort them, but you still keep the boundary.
Love doesn’t remove structure; it provides it.

Love doesn’t change the truth to avoid discomfort.

It teaches how to live with others

It builds responsibility, not convenience

It teaches patience and self-control

It shows how to navigate disappointment

It builds resilience, not dependency

And it prepares them for the real world, not comfort

This is Love 💛 and this is what matters in the early years
